NEW PLYMOUTH CITY COUNCIL

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E

PURSUANT to the provisions of the Local Authorities Loans Act
1956, the New Plymouth City Council hereby resolves as
follows:

"That, for the purpose of providing as much of the principal
as is due and owing, together with interest thereon, on a loan
of six thousand dollars ($6,000) to be known as the Forestry
Encouragement Loan 1969 authorised to be raised by the
New Plymouth City Council under the above-mentioned Act
for the purpose of establishing and maintaining an afforestation
area, the New Plymouth City Council hereby makes a special
rate of nought decimal nought nought one two cents (0.0012c)
in the dollar upon the rateable value (on the basis of the unim-
proved value) of all rateable property in the City of New
Plymouth; and that the said special rate shall be an annual-
recurring rate during the currency of the loan and be payable
half-yearly on the 1st day of April and the 1st day of October
in each and every year during the currency of the loan, being a
period of forty (40) years or until as much of the principal as
is due and owing, together with interest thereon, is fully paid
off."

The above resolution was passed at a meeting of the New
Plymouth City Council held on the 18th day of August 1969.
W. J. CONNOR, Town Clerk.

NEW PLYMOUTH CITY COUNCIL

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E

PURSUANT to the provisions of the Local Authorities Loans Act
1956, the New Plymouth City Council hereby resolves as
follows:

"That, for the purpose of providing the annual charges on a
loan of seventeen thousand three hundred and eighty-eight
dollars ($17,388), to be known as the Pensioners' Housing
Loan 1969, authorised to be raised by the New Plymouth City
Council under the above-mentioned Act for the purpose of
erecting accommodation for old people, the New Plymouth
City Council hereby makes a special rate of nought decimal
nought nought four five cents (0.0045c) in the dollar upon the
rateable value (on the basis of the unimproved value) of all
rateable property within the City of New Plymouth; and that
the said special rate shall be an annual-recurring rate during
the currency of the loan and be payable on the 1st day of
April and the 1st day of October in each and every year
during the currency of the loan, being a period of twenty-five
(25) years or until the loan is fully paid off."

The above resolution was passed at a meeting of the New
Plymouth City Council held on the 18th day of August 1969.
W. J. CONNOR, Town Clerk.

THE WANGANUI-RANGITIKEI ELECTRIC-POWER
BOARD

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E

PURSUANT to the Local Authorities Loans Act 1956, the
Wanganui-Rangitikei Electric-power Board hereby resolves as
follows:

"That, for the purpose of providing the annual charges on a
loan of $500,000 authorised to be raised by the Wanganui-
Rangitikei Electric-power Board under the above-mentioned
Act for the purpose of extending and improving the electrical
reticulation within its district, the said Wanganui-Rangitikei
Electric-power Board hereby makes a special rate of decimal
nought two four of a cent (.024c) in the dollar on the rateable
value (on the basis of the capital value) of all the rateable
property in the Wanganui-Rangitikei Electric-power District;
and that such special rate be an annual-recurring rate during
the currency of the aforesaid loan and shall be payable yearly
on the 1st day of April in each and every year during the
currency of the said loan, but not exceeding a period of twenty
(20) years or until the loan is fully paid off."

The above resolution was duly passed at a meeting of the
Wanganui-Rangitikei Electric-power Board held at Wanganui
on the 19th day of August 1969.
D. J. BOSWELL, General Manager.

WELLINGTON CITY COUNCIL

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E

Drainage Loan 1969, $600,000

The following resolution was duly passed at a meeting of the
Wellington City Council held on the 13th day of August 1969:
"Pursuant to the Local Authorities Loans Act 1956, the
Wellington City Council hereby resolves as follows:

"That, for the purpose of providing the annual charges on
a loan of six hundred thousand dollars ($600,000) to be known
as the Drainage Loan 1969, of $600,000, authorised to be raised
by the Wellington City Council under the above-mentioned Act
for the purpose of meeting the cost of drainage works, the
Wellington City Council hereby makes a special rate of decimal
nought three five of a cent (.035c) in the dollar on the rateable
value (on the basis of the unimproved value) of all rateable
property within the whole of the City of Wellington; and that
the said special rate shall be an annual-recurring rate during
the currency of such loan and shall be payable yearly on the
1st day of April in each year during the currency of the said
loan, being a period of twenty-five (25) years or until the loan
is fully paid off."
F. W. PRINGLE, Town Clerk.

PICTON BOROUGH COUNCIL

NOTICE OF MAKING SPECIAL ORDER TO RAISE LOAN

PURSUANT to section 13 (2A) of the Local Authorities Loans
Act 1956, notice is hereby given that the special order to raise
a loan of $40,000, to be known as the Picton Borough Council
Works Loan 1969, $40,000, for the purpose of purchasing plant,
installing water mains, and sewerage reticulation has been duly
made in terms of the relevant statutes; and that 5 percent or
more of the ratepayers have not demanded that a poll be taken
on the proposal.

Dated this 22nd day of August 1969.
B. J. DALLIESSI, Mayor.

PICTON BOROUGH COUNCIL

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E

Works Loan 1969, $40,000

PURSUANT to the Local Authorities Loans Act 1956, the Picton
Borough Council hereby resolves as follows:

That, for the purpose of providing the annual charges on a
loan of $40,000 authorised to be raised by the Picton Borough
Council under the above-mentioned Act for the purpose of
purchasing plant and installing water mains and sewer reticula-
tion, the said Picton Borough Council hereby makes a special
rate of 0.38c in the dollar on the unimproved rateable value
of all rateable property appearing on the valuation roll of the
Borough of Picton; and that the special rate shall be an
annual-recurring rate during the currency of the loan and be
payable yearly on the 1st day of April in each year during the
currency of the loan, being a period of 10 years or until the
loan is fully paid off.
R. C. PENINGTON, Town Clerk.
